Enter the number of sheets that should be fed from
the Model F601 per set using the arrow buttons. The
range is 1 to 45 sheets per set. Default value is 1.
1
If running on-line with the Model F610, multiple sheets
per set should only be run portrait.
Enter the length of the inserts (in the feed direction)
using the arrow buttons. The range is 100 to 310 mm.
Default value is 200 mm. Use the scale attached to
the unit to measure the length of the booklet.
Enter the number of sets per hour using the arrow
buttons. The range is 1000 to 3600 sets per hour.
Default value is 1800. The speed will however be
limited to match units attached. When running the
machine do not change speed by more than 1000
SPH at a time, it can create interruption.
Belt speed is how fast each insert will be fed. Adjust
to determine the position of the booklet on the Model
F610. Enter a percentage using the arrow buttons.
The range is 60 to 100%. Default value is 80%. If the
belt speed is too slow the inserts might have problems
to "leaving" the Model F601. If the belt speed is too
high, single sheets might turn over when they are fed
and booklets might bounce back.
Module Priority is similar to the ID number and decides
the order of the inserts in the envelope. Lowest number
feeds first and so on. For example, the table on page
5 shows that the Model F601 feeds first and then the
Model F612/F615.
Select language using the arrow buttons.
Starts the self diagnosis when the OK button is
pressed. Memory, sensors, feed belt motor and the
voltage supplied is checked.
See section 6 for error messages, explanations and
actions to be taken.
